CASE: The Role of Labour Costs
Summary of Case
The case provides a brief history of the electronics retailer, Best Buy and its takeover a Canadian retailer, Future Shop. The differences in compensation between the two are firms are highlighted. The case describes various cost-saving measures taken by Best Buy in response to slowing sales and increased competition from Amazon and Walmart, among others. Savings were achieved through store closures, job cuts and reductions in compensation for Best Buy employees. The corporate culture of Best Buy is characterized. Stock prices for 11 years, 2009-2019 for Best Buy, Amazon, and Walmart are presented.
-Is replacement of highly-paid workers with lower-paid workers a good idea to ensure a company's success?
